    Petty Officer 2nd Class Kristopher Hill tends to a line attached to an engine that was removed from a Coast Guard Station Portage 47-foot response boat, March 31, 2014. Engineers at the station began the lifecycle maintenance task of replacing both engines on the response boat after the two new engines arrived the day before.
